Connecting with plants and flowers will improve your mood.

Many people believe that plants and flowers have a calming effect on the mind and can improve moods. Studies suggest that exposure to plants can reduce stress levels, while also improving mental health outcomes such as depression and anxiety. Additionally, flowers may boost feelings of well-being by releasing fragrant oils and scents. Whether or not you believe in the purported mental benefits of plants and flowers, spending time in nature is sure to be beneficially relaxing for your mind and spirit.
